Analysis
Poland recorded 2.9% for inflation, gdp deflator in 2025.
That represents a change of down 24.0% on the previous year and up 120.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, inflation, gdp deflator in Poland peaked at 55.3% in 1991 and was at its lowest, 0.1%, in 2016.
Poland ranks 123rd of 212 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
Inflation as measured by the annual growth rate of the GDP implicit deflator shows the rate of price change in the economy as a whole. The GDP implicit deflator is the ratio of GDP in current local currency to GDP in constant local currency.
